    I guess I don't see the same cheating as everyone else.  I run Rat Lab and while there have been a few cheaters on when I'm on, it's been pretty sparse.  I see more lag than anything.  I try to help laggy players out if possible by making suggestions to increase udp throughput and fps.

    I'm a laggy offender as well.  I dial (He said as he quickly ducks behind a chair to avoid the rotten vegitables and eggs being hurled his way.) because it's all I can get and I have been accused of cheating way too often.

    I do not prescribe to the BZCop attitude either.  Too many laggy players get banned for poor reasons.  Yes, banned, not kicked.  What a travesty of justice.  ( I guess I didn't make any friends there, huh?)  If someone is accused of cheating I watch, I wait and I privately ask the player if they are having a problem.

    If someone suspects a cheater on my server, after trying to help resolve any difficulties with the other player, then email me.  I'll watch for them.  I'm zippy@machlink.com.  But please don't assume that I will automatically ban someone who truly isn't cheating and is being turned off to a great game by people who just might be a little quick to use the "c" word.  I'll use due diligence and investigate a bit first.

    It's really funny when I, or the other person who has the admin rights on Rat Lab get called a cheater for having a 200ms lag.  It just proves to me that the word is used way too often.

    If more admin is needed, I'll decide who gets the right to administer my server, not by a popular vote, or by any authority not my own.  I'm not a dictator either.  There are a couple of people I'm considering.  But the point is, it's my server and I'll make the decisions on who to trust with the priveledge.

    Please yell at me if this has been suggested before (i'm new here).
    But it seems that the problem is that the problem is that the clients are getting too much information about whats going on in the game to reduce network traffic.  Then why don't we have the clients check for cheating?
    Since the clients know so much, they can probably detect with some degree of certantity that someone else is cheating.  The client would add up all these probabilities for each other person in the game and once the sum reaches some threshold, report the cheater to the server.  And once the server gets enough evidence of cheating from the clients it can ban them.
    This scheme assumes that most of the clients are not cheaters of course.
